Job description

Job Description

As an Engineer within the Asset Consultancy Team you would work in a team environment alongside other WSP Engineers, Hydraulic Modellers and Asset Planners in the delivery of potable water infrastructure projects. Your responsibilities will involve ensuring accurate and efficient delivery of high‑profile projects for internal & external clients that primarily involve UK utilities but also private developers and local authorities. You will exercise independent engineering judgement and have the opportunity to provide innovative solutions to engineering problems. You will be a proactive and collaborative team member.

The role will enable you to further develop and use your technical skills, applying your expertise to help us continue driving forward in terms of both technical quality and service efficiency.

You will work as part of an award‑winning water team within a larger team of over 600 professionals across the UK, supported by our Global Water Team. We are currently engaged with an expanding portfolio of clients, including Severn Trent Water, Northern Ireland Water, Welsh Water, Southern Water, Wessex Water, United Utilities, Uisce Éireann, Southern Water, and Scottish Water Horizons.

A typical week would include (but not be limited to)
  • Delivery of feasibility studies / options development for potable water (infrastructure and/or non‑infrastructure).
  • Hydraulic modelling (network model builds/upgrades/calibration/operational response/mains flushing programming)
  • Asset risk prioritisation modelling
  • Water quality modelling, assessment of options and development of solutions
  • Growth studies and network capacity checks
  • Work closely with clients to ensure projects are delivered to their expectations in terms of quality, time and budget
  • Undertaking own continuing professional development under guidance from people managers and assisting junior staff with the same
  • Operating in accordance with the corporate health and safety, environmental and quality standards of WSP and associated client requirements
  • Maintain project‑related health and safety strategies, including risk assessments, and
  • Operate in accordance with the corporate health and safety, environment and quality standards
  • Successful candidates will become part of a respected and ambitious company with excellent career prospects
What We Will Be Looking For You To Demonstrate
  • A relevant degree and progression towards qualification with an applicable Professional Institution. You will have a solid background in clean water infrastructure including a good understanding of asset management and/or design within the water industry. You will have a proven and demonstrable background of delivering potable water projects (modelling/design and/or asset management) to a high standard.
  • You will have good presentation, written and verbal communication skills in English. You will have the ability to work on your own initiative on technical matters and provide support to others within the team.
  • Good IT skills are paramount, in particular MS Office, GIS and network modelling software packages (e.g. InfoWorks WS Pro, Synergi, Epanet) as well as the ability to pick up new software.
  • This role is likely to involve client‑facing activities, so professionalism and excellent communication skills are a must.
